UNPKG

stylelint-order

Version:

A collection of order related linting rules for Stylelint.

82 lines (81 loc) 1.96 kB
{ "name": "stylelint-order", "version": "7.0.0", "description": "A collection of order related linting rules for Stylelint.", "keywords": [ "stylelint-plugin", "stylelint", "css", "lint", "order" ], "author": "Aleks Hudochenkov <aleks@hudochenkov.com>", "license": "MIT", "repository": "hudochenkov/stylelint-order", "files": [ "rules", "utils", "!**/tests", "!**/__tests__", "index.js", "!.DS_Store" ], "type": "module", "exports": "./index.js", "engines": { "node": ">=20.19.0" }, "dependencies": { "postcss": "^8.5.3", "postcss-sorting": "^9.1.0" }, "peerDependencies": { "stylelint": "^16.18.0" }, "devDependencies": { "eslint": "^9.24.0", "eslint-config-hudochenkov": "^11.0.0", "eslint-config-prettier": "^10.1.2", "globals": "^16.0.0", "husky": "^9.1.7", "jest": "^29.7.0", "jest-light-runner": "^0.7.4", "jest-preset-stylelint": "^7.3.0", "jest-watch-typeahead": "^2.2.2", "lint-staged": "^15.5.1", "postcss-html": "^1.8.0", "postcss-less": "^6.0.0", "postcss-styled-syntax": "^0.7.1", "prettier": "~3.5.3", "prettier-config-hudochenkov": "^0.4.0", "stylelint": "^16.18.0" }, "scripts": { "lint": "eslint . --max-warnings 0 && prettier '**/*.js' --check", "test": "node --experimental-vm-modules node_modules/jest/bin/jest.js", "watch": "npm run test -- --watch", "coverage": "npm run test -- --coverage", "fix": "eslint . --fix --max-warnings 0 && prettier '**/*.js' --write", "prepare": "husky" }, "lint-staged": { "*.js": [ "eslint --fix --max-warnings 0", "prettier --write" ] }, "jest": { "runner": "jest-light-runner", "preset": "jest-preset-stylelint", "setupFiles": [ "./jest-setup.js" ], "watchPlugins": [ "jest-watch-typeahead/filename", "jest-watch-typeahead/testname" ], "testEnvironment": "node", "testRegex": ".*\\.test\\.js$|rules/.*/tests/.*\\.js$" }, "prettier": "prettier-config-hudochenkov" }